The Solution Architect About us: The Future Joint Command and Staff Trainer (FJCAST) programme will transform the delivery of senior staff training, enabling Joint Headquarters, operational commands, coalition partners and allied nations to train together across Land, Maritime, Air, Space and Cyberspace domains. Through the integration of simulation, synthetic environments, exercise design, data exploitation, operational networks and coalition interoperability, FJCAST will support the training, preparation, experimentation and evaluation of UK and allied operational headquarters.

The role

The Solution Architect will support the Chief Engineer in the development and delivery of a secure, interoperable, and data-driven Joint Collective Training capability. The role is responsible for analysing customer requirements and designing the end-to-end technical solutions that underpin collective training across UK Defence, NATO, coalition partners, and multi-domain operational environments. The Solution Architect will lead the development of architectures spanning modelling and simulation, synthetic environments, exercise support systems, operational CIS, data exploitation platforms, networking, distributed edge computing, and training management systems. Working across a diverse ecosystem of Defence customers, technology providers, simulation partners, and engineering teams, the Solution Architect will ensure that individual systems are integrated into a coherent training ecosystem capable of delivering realistic, scalable, and operationally relevant Tier 3 and Tier 4 collective training exercises. The role combines solution architecture, systems integration, simulation architecture, networking, distributed computing, Secure by Design principles, and requirements engineering to deliver measurable training outcomes and operational readiness.
